Output 03dafb625dc037c91c64c2a2dff5902b7d3eaf2a9640d93826142e62cbbb2956:1

value
2875786
script pubkey
OP_0 OP_PUSHBYTES_20 04beda1c32f972a7f8dadeede227a2d1d88a0424
address
ltc1qqjld58pjl9e207x6mmk7yfaz68vg5ppyqeqxc5
transaction
03dafb625dc037c91c64c2a2dff5902b7d3eaf2a9640d93826142e62cbbb2956
spent
true